Doc: 15.2 Principal component analysis 15.2.1 Theory  The goal of Principal Component Analysis (PCA) is to replace a set of m variables x1; x2;    xm, which may be correlated, by another set f1; f2;    fm, called the principal components or principal factors. These factors are inde- pendent (uncorrelated) variables. Usually, the algorithm starts with the correlation matrix R which is a mm symmetric matrix such that Rij is the correlation coecient between variable xi and variable xj . The eigenvalues 1; 2;    m (in decreasing order) of matrix R are the variances of the principal factors. Their sum Pp i=1 i is equal to m. So, the percentage of variance associated with the i-th factor is equal to i=m. 15.2.2 Programming The following subroutines are available:  VecMean(X, Lb, Ub, Nvar, M) computes the mean vector M[1..Nvar] from matrix X[Lb..Ub, 1..Nvar].  VecSD(X, Lb, Ub, Nvar, M, S) computes the standard deviations S[1..Nvar] from matrix X and mean vector M.  ScaleVar(X, Lb, Ub, Nvar, M, S, Z) computes the scaled variables Z[Lb..Ub, 1..Nvar] from the original variables X, the means M and the standard deviations S.  MatVarCov(X, Lb, Ub, Nvar, M, V) computes the variance-covariance matrix V[1..Nvar, 1..Nvar] from matrix X and mean vector M.  MatCorrel(V, Nvar, R) computes the correlation matrix R[1..Nvar, 1..Nvar] from the variance-covariance matrix V.  PCA(R, Nvar, MaxIter, Tol, Lambda, C, Rc) performs the princi- pal component analysis of the correlation matrix R, which is destroyed. MaxIter and Tol are the maximum number of iterations and the re- quested tolerance for the Jacobi method (see paragraph 6.9.2). The eigenvalues are returned in vector Lambda[1..Nvar], the eigenvec- tors in the columns of matrix C[1..Nvar, 1..Nvar]. The matrix Rc[1..Nvar, 1..Nvar] contains the correlation coecients (loadings) between the original variables (rows) and the principal factors (columns).  PrinFac(Z, Lb, Ub, Nvar, C, F) computes the principal factors (scores) F[Lb..Ub, 1..Nvar] from the scaled variables Z and the matrix of eigenvectors C. After a call to these procedures, function MathErr returns one of the following error codes:  MatOk if no error occurred  MatErrDim if the array dimensions do not match  MatNonConv if the iterative procedure (Jacobi method) did not converge in subroutine PCA 126
